The Shielding of Badal
Within the divine city of Mecca, a peaceful air infuses the atmosphere. This is due in part to the presence of celebrated structure known as the Veil of Badal. This monumental veil {servesas a tangible barrier, adequately separating this innermost sanctuary of the Kaaba from the devotees who gather